Is This The Most Prized Commodity Of All Time?


The most prized commodity to date is a topic of much debate, as it varies depending on who you ask and what time period you are referring to. Throughout history, different commodities have been highly valued for their rarity, usefulness, or cultural significance. However, one commodity that has consistently been in high demand and highly valued is gold.

Gold has been prized by humans for thousands of years. It has been used as a currency, a symbol of wealth and power, and as a decorative material. Gold is rare, durable, and does not corrode, making it a valuable and long-lasting material. In ancient times, gold was used to make coins, jewelry, and other decorative objects. It was also used as a form of currency, with gold coins being traded for goods and services.

Today, gold is still highly valued and is traded as a commodity on global markets. It is used in a variety of industries, including jewelry, electronics, and dentistry. Gold is also considered a safe-haven asset, meaning that investors often turn to gold during times of economic uncertainty or market volatility.

Gold is not the only commodity that has been highly prized throughout history. Other commodities that have been valued for their rarity, usefulness, or cultural significance include diamonds, silk, spices, and oil. These commodities have played a significant role in global trade and have shaped the course of history.

In recent years, there has been increasing interest in alternative commodities that are seen as more sustainable or ethical. For example, some investors are turning to renewable energy sources such as solar and wind power, which are seen as more environmentally friendly than traditional energy sources such as oil and gas. Other commodities that are gaining popularity include rare earth metals, which are used in electronics and renewable energy technologies, and water, which is becoming increasingly scarce in many parts of the world.

In conclusion, the most prized commodity to date is a topic of much debate, but gold has consistently been valued throughout history for its rarity, usefulness, and cultural significance. While other commodities have also been highly prized, gold remains a symbol of wealth and power, and is still traded as a commodity on global markets. As the world changes and new technologies and industries emerge, the most prized commodity may continue to evolve, but it is likely that gold will remain a valuable and highly sought-after material for many years to come.
